    The Learning Edge Podcast - Episode 1 - feat. Nils Romier, Group Head of Learning at AXA

    In this inaugural episode of The Learning Edge, Eric Halvorsen interviews Nils Romier, Group Head of Learning at AXA. Nils shares his journey through various roles in the learning space, including consulting, entrepreneurship, and his current position at AXA. He reflects on his early professional experiences, when he first engaged with training and change management, and how his passion for learning has been a constant throughout his career. Nils emphasizes the importance of being at the intersection of people development, organizational change, and technology.Nils also elaborates on the multifaceted role of a CLO, highlighting the necessity of being a business partner who understands company strategies and workforce evolution.
